前言:最近在研究Handler的知识,其中涉及到一个问题,如何避免Handler带来的内存溢出问题。在网上找了很多资料,有很多都是互相抄的,没有实际的作用。 本文的内存泄漏检测工具是:LeakCanary github地址:https://github.com/square ...
有过痛苦的经历,特别能写出深刻的文章 凯尔文. 肖 直接内存是IO框架的绝配,但直接内存的分配销毁不易,所以使用内存池能大幅提高性能,也告别了频繁的GC。但,要重新培养被Java的自动垃圾回收惯坏了的惰性。 Netty有一篇必读的文档官方文档翻译:引用计数对象,在此基础上补充一些自己的理解和细节。 .为什么要有引用计数器 Netty里四种主力的ByteBuf,其中UnpooledHeapByteB ...
2016-01-29 11:31 1 10259 推荐指数:
前言:最近在研究Handler的知识,其中涉及到一个问题,如何避免Handler带来的内存溢出问题。在网上找了很多资料,有很多都是互相抄的,没有实际的作用。 本文的内存泄漏检测工具是:LeakCanary github地址:https://github.com/square ...
各位小伙伴们好,我们接着上一篇,来讨论下为了保证项目例会能够顺利进行,我们应该如何有效的进行规避风险,如何进行有效的应对。 上一期分享,我们简单的罗列下项目例会这个项目可能会遇到的风险,比如预定的会议室被临时占用,会议室的投影仪无法投影,主要的干系人请假/出差等风险,这些风险我们怎么能 ...
开发或者修改过的模块的内存状况。 iOS设备性能越来越好,iOS App 也相应的变得越来越庞大,A ...
Paul Hiles: 3 ways to avoid an anemic domain model in EF Core 1.引言 在使用ORM中(比如Entity Framew ...
获取状态栏高度 一、传统方式:有时获取为0,解决方法看 二 ...
WordPress忘记密码找回登录密码的四种行之有效的方法 PS:20170214更新,感谢SuperDoge同学提供的方法,登入phpMyAdmin后,先从左边选自己的数据库,然后点上面的 SQL 标签页,执行下面命令: UPDATE ...
从进程发出指定逻辑地址的访问请求,经过地址变换,到在内存中找到对应的实际物理地址单元并取出数据,所需花费的总时间,称为内存的有效访问时间(Effective Access Time, ETA) 在 基本分页存储管理 方式中: 有效访问时间分为第一次访问内存时间(即查找页表对应的页表项所消耗 ...
静默式活体检测,是华为HMS Core机器学习服务所属的人脸活体检测能力,即无需用户配合做出张嘴、扭头、眨眼等动作,便可实时捕捉人脸,快速判断是否为活体,用户使用过程便捷,综合体验感较佳。 技术原理 ...